Witrynacolumns Index or array-like. Column labels to use for resulting frame when data does not have them, defaulting to RangeIndex(0, 1, 2, …, n). If data contains column labels, will perform column selection instead. dtype dtype, default None. Data type to force. Only a single dtype is allowed. If None, infer. copy bool or None, default None.
